Cookies

What is a cookie?

A cookie is simply a small text file. It isn’t a program and doesn’t actively do anything on your computer. They help to tailor information and marketing messages that best suit you (based on your browsing history). Cookies do not harm your computer. For detailed information on cookies, and how to manage them, take a look at www.allaboutcookies.org.

Why do we use cookies?

Like most sites, we use cookies for several reasons, the main reasons being:

  • Analytics & Tracking – we use cookies to understand how the site is being used in order to improve the user experience. User data is anonymous
  • Remarketing – we use these cookies to show relevant adverts to users who have previously visited our site, as they browse other websites. We also use these cookies to generate profile information in order to allow us to market to people with similar profiles. Remarketing services we use include both Google and Facebook. We recommend that you allow cookies so your experience isn’t hindered, as they allow our site to operate to its potential. However, you can choose to opt-out of receiving our cookies at any time. Do bear in mind that your experience may not be as smooth as some of our functionality depends on them.
